Understanding Government Benefits

Government benefits can take many forms, including unclaimed property, grants, and tax credits. Unclaimed property refers to financial assets like forgotten bank accounts or uncashed checks. According to the National Association of Unclaimed Property Administrators (NAUPA), billions of dollars in unclaimed property exist nationwide.

Steps to Claim Unclaimed Property

Here's how you can claim unclaimed property:

  1. Visit USA.gov to search for unclaimed property in your state.
  2. Enter your personal information to see if you have unclaimed assets.
  3. Follow the instructions to file a claim and provide necessary documentation.

Exploring Government Grants

Government grants are funds provided by the government for specific purposes, such as education or business start-ups. The Federal Grant Registry is a comprehensive source for finding these opportunities. Most grants require an application process and may have specific eligibility criteria.

Understanding Tax Credits

Tax credits reduce the amount of tax you owe. Some popular credits include the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C) and the Child Tax Credit. According to the IRS, these credits can offer significant savings, often exceeding $500 for eligible taxpayers.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is unclaimed property?

Unclaimed property refers to financial assets left inactive by their owners, such as bank accounts or stock dividends. The state holds these assets until claimed.

How can I find government grants?

You can find government grants by searching the Federal Grant Registry or visiting Grants.gov. Be sure to check eligibility requirements before applying.

What are tax credits?

Tax credits are amounts that reduce the total tax you owe. They can provide significant savings, and some are refundable, meaning you can receive a refund even if you owe no taxes.

How do I claim a tax credit?

You typically claim tax credits when you file your tax return. Be sure to check eligibility criteria and gather any required documentation.
